题目内容

已知两个长度分别为m和n的升序单链表,若将它们合并为一个长度为m+n的升序单链表,则最好情况下的时间复杂度是( )。

A. O(n)
B. O(m*n)
C. O(MIN(m,n))
D. O(MAX(m,n))

查看答案
更多问题

在长度为n(n≥1)的双链表中插入一个结点(非尾结点)要修改( )各指针域。

A. 1
B. 2
C. 3
D. 4

非空的循环单链表L的尾结点(由p所指向)满足( )。

A. p-〉next==null
B. p==null
C. p-〉next==L
D. p==L

在长度为n(n≥1)的循环双链表L中,删除尾结点的时间复杂度为( )

A. O(1)
B. O(n)
C. O(n2)
D. O(nlog2n)

设计一个算法删除单链表L中第一个值为x的结点。

答案查题题库